Abstract

The research departs from the fact that the level of knowledge and skills of students in dealing with the earthquake in Lombok is low. Meanwhile, social science learning in schools does not contribute to the formation of students' knowledge and skills in dealing with earthquakes. In fact, the island of Lombok is an area with a high level of vulnerability to earthquake disasters in Indonesia. Thus, in this study, the main objective is to develop earthquake mitigation media sourced from the Sasak indigenous people themselves and allotment for schools in Lombok. The research method used is a research and development approach. From the research and development process, several results were obtained including: First, the more effective the learning process for teachers and students because they used earthquake mitigation media based on values ​​that existed in the Sasak community themselves; Second, the results of both quantitative and qualitative analysis show that earthquake mitigation media based on the value of the bale beleq architecture are able to improve the school's mitigation capability against earthquake disasters. So with the architectural value-based mitigation media that exists in the Sasak community itself, teachers and students are more effective and efficient in order to improve the ability of earthquake disaster mitigation in schools.
